Overview of Nebactrina

Quick Facts

Property Description
Active Ingredients Bacitracin Zinc, Neomycin Sulfate
Form Topical Ointment, Dusting Powder
Pharmacological Class Combination Antibiotic, Anti-infective agent
Common Use Localized Anti-infective Protection
Origin Natural/Biological (Bacitracin) and Semi-synthetic (Neomycin)

Nebactrina is a pharmaceutical preparation classified as a topical combination antibiotic, specifically designed for application to the skin or the external surface of the eye. This combination of active agents places the product within the high-level anti-infective agent group, intended strictly for localized use rather than systemic treatment.

1. Classification and Combination Identity

Nebactrina is identified as a combination antibiotic because it incorporates two active ingredients from different pharmacological families to broaden its antimicrobial reach. This approach differs from monotherapies by combining the actions of distinct agents, intended to maximize the probability of effective bacterial disruption against susceptible microbes. The product is fundamentally classified as a topical anti-infective, confining its primary action to the site of application for conditions such as minor skin injuries.

2. Active Ingredients and Physical Form

The core ingredients of the formulation are the two anti-infective agents: Bacitracin (often stabilized as Bacitracin Zinc) and Neomycin (typically as Neomycin Sulfate). Bacitracin is a peptide compound produced by Bacillus bacteria, giving it a natural or biological origin. Neomycin is derived from the bacterium Streptomyces fradiae. This composition is significant because Bacitracin inhibits bacterial cell wall synthesis, while Neomycin interferes with protein synthesis, offering a dual strategy against bacterial growth. The medicine is commonly available in the form of an ointment (an oil-based vehicle) or a dusting powder, with the required route of administration being strictly topical for application to the dermal or ocular surfaces.

3. General Therapeutic Purpose

The overall function of the Neomycin and Bacitracin combination is to provide localized broad-spectrum antibacterial action at the site of application. By combining two ingredients that attack bacteria through different pathways, the product aims to stop the growth and proliferation of susceptible bacteria. This integrated effect serves the general purpose of furnishing localized anti-infective protection, for example, in the management of superficial cuts and scrapes, to support the body's natural healing processes.

What side effects are possible with Nebactrina?

Possible Side Effects and Safety Information

This section outlines the officially documented adverse effects and safety characteristics for topical Bacitracin-Neomycin combination products (Nebactrina), based strictly on government regulatory sources.

Official Adverse Reactions and Frequency

Adverse reactions associated with this topical combination are primarily localized. The most frequently reported reaction is allergic sensitization, although the exact incidence is classified as Not Known in regulatory documentation.

System Organ Class Documented Adverse Reactions Frequency Classification
Skin and Subcutaneous Tissue Disorders Allergic Sensitization Reactions, Skin Rash, Itching, Local Irritation, Contact Dermatitis Not Known
Ear and Labyrinth Disorders Ototoxicity (Hearing Loss) Rare
Renal and Urinary Disorders Nephrotoxicity (Kidney Toxicity) Rare

Documented Serious Adverse Reactions

Serious systemic effects are rare but are documented in regulatory labeling, primarily associated with significant systemic absorption of Neomycin:

  • Ototoxicity: Potential for permanent sensorineural hearing loss. The risk is increased with prolonged use.
  • Nephrotoxicity: Potential for kidney damage.
  • Anaphylaxis: Rare, severe systemic hypersensitivity reaction.

Safety Constraints and Special Populations

The risk of systemic toxicity rises when the product is applied over large body surface areas, on wounds, burns, or ulcerations where the skin barrier is compromised.

  • Prolonged Use carries an increased risk of toxicity and the potential for the overgrowth of non-susceptible organisms (superinfection).
  • Patients with Renal Impairment are at a higher hazard for ototoxicity and nephrotoxicity if systemic absorption occurs.
  • Pregnancy and Lactation: Use should be approached with caution due to the theoretical risk of systemic absorption and fetal or infant exposure.

Overdose and Emergency Response

The officially documented risk of overdose with this topical product is associated with systemic absorption following accidental ingestion or application over extensive areas of damaged skin. Regulatory information classifies this risk based on potential severe systemic toxic effects linked to the active ingredients, primarily Neomycin and Bacitracin. The profile is organized around the severity of these events.

Documented Manifestations and Severe Outcomes

Overdose may present with signs of nephrotoxicity and ototoxicity. Documented clinical manifestations include hearing problems (risk of irreversible sensorineural hearing loss) and a change in the amount of urine. Following oral ingestion, symptoms may include stomach pain and vomiting. Life-threatening outcomes that require immediate intervention are collapse, seizure, or difficulty breathing. No specific antidote is known for this combination. Management is described as symptomatic and supportive, and renal impairment increases the risk of systemic toxicity.

When to Seek Urgent Medical Help

Government regulatory guidance mandates seeking immediate medical attention or contacting a Poison Control Center for any suspected overdose or accidental swallowing. If the individual is experiencing collapse, seizure, or severe trouble breathing, the official instruction is to call emergency services immediately. Further medical management requires monitoring renal function and hearing acuity, and procedures like haemodialysis may be used to reduce Neomycin levels in cases of confirmed significant systemic absorption.

Therapeutic Uses of Nebactrina

Quick Facts

  • Primary Domain: First aid for minor skin injuries
  • Therapeutic Focus: Reducing the risk of infection
  • Context of Use: Minor cuts, scrapes, and burns

Nebactrina (a combination of Bacitracin and Neomycin) is used as a first-aid measure for minor skin injuries. The primary function is to help reduce the potential for infection in superficial wounds such as small cuts, minor scrapes, and mild burns.

The application of this topical preparation on the affected area is intended to maintain a hygienic environment that is not conducive to bacterial growth, supporting the skin’s natural process of recovery from minor trauma.

Healthcare professionals often recommend this combination product for its utility in mitigating the risk of bacterial contamination that can occur with everyday minor skin breaches. This approach is common in the management of small topical injuries.

This medication is solely intended for external use and for addressing minor injuries; it is not suitable for deep wounds, puncture wounds, or severe burns, which require medical intervention.

Eligibility and Restrictions for Use

Who Can and Cannot Use Nebactrina (Bacitracin, Neomycin)?

Official regulatory information strictly defines eligibility to avoid serious risks, mainly due to potential systemic absorption of the neomycin component.


Absolute Contraindications

Classification Exclusion Criteria (As stated in label)
Hypersensitivity Individuals with a known allergy to bacitracin, neomycin, or other aminoglycoside antibiotics (due to cross-sensitivity).
Specific Conditions Viral (e.g., Herpes), Fungal, or Tuberculous lesions of the skin; use in the ear if the eardrum is perforated.

Eligibility Restrictions and Special Populations

  • Skin/Wound Status: Use is restricted on large areas of the body, denuded skin, or serious burns. This restriction is mandatory because large-area application increases the risk of neomycin systemic absorption, which carries a risk of ototoxicity (hearing damage) and nephrotoxicity (kidney damage).
  • Pediatric Use: Safety and effectiveness are often stated as not established in pediatric patients, requiring careful consideration before use.
  • Pregnancy and Lactation: Regulatory bodies advise caution or state that the medicine should be used only if clearly needed during pregnancy. Caution is also advised when administering to a nursing woman, as it is not known if the drug is excreted in human milk.

What should I know about interactions with other medicines?

The official regulatory profile for this topical combination is defined by the potential for the Neomycin component to achieve systemic absorption, which introduces interaction risks typical of an aminoglycoside antibiotic when applied to large surface areas or damaged skin. Official documentation restricts co-administration with other potentially nephrotoxic or neurotoxic drugs, including other systemic aminoglycosides. This restriction addresses the formally documented risk of additive neurotoxicity and nephrotoxicity should systemic exposure occur.

A second interaction domain involves pharmacodynamic potentiation. Neomycin exhibits a curare-like effect that may be officially amplified by neuromuscular blocking agents, such as Tubocurarine or Succinylcholine, which increases the formal risk of neuromuscular blockade. Furthermore, the co-administration of potent diuretics, including Ethacrynic acid and Furosemide, should be formally avoided. These diuretics are cited as potentially enhancing Neomycin toxicity due to additive ototoxicity and modifications in antibiotic concentration.

Regulatory labels also contain population-specific notes, stating the risk of systemic interaction is increased for patients of advanced age and those with pre-existing neuromuscular disorders.

Mechanism of Action

The mechanism of Nebactrina involves the synergistic actions of its two components on bacterial cellular processes.

Bacitracin acts as a non-competitive antagonist by binding with high affinity to undecaprenyl pyrophosphate ( C55 PP), a lipid carrier essential for bacterial cell wall biosynthesis. This interaction, which is metal-ion dependent (typically Zn^2+), prevents the dephosphorylation of C55 PP to the active undecaprenyl phosphate ( C55 P), thereby arresting the recycling of the carrier molecule. The resulting intracellular pathway cascade is a failure to transport peptidoglycan precursors across the cell membrane for assembly. This halts the synthesis of the murein layer, leading to structural integrity compromise at the system level.

Neomycin, an aminoglycoside, enters the bacterial cell through the cell envelope, targeting the 30S ribosomal subunit. It binds irreversibly to the 16S ribosomal RNA within the A-site, functioning as an inhibitor of protein synthesis. This interaction disrupts the translocation step of translation and induces tRNA mismatching, causing the ribosome to misread the mRNA code. The downstream cascade involves the production of aberrant, non-functional proteins, which rapidly disrupts critical intracellular enzymatic and structural processes, resulting in system-level cessation of microbial viability.

Dosage and Administration Information

Nebactrina, a combination of the topical antibiotics Bacitracin and Neomycin (often combined with Polymyxin B in over-the-counter products), is used to help prevent infection in minor cuts, scrapes, and burns. It is for external use on the skin only. Use this medication exactly as directed by your healthcare provider or as instructed on the package label.


Application Instructions

  1. Clean the Area: Before applying the ointment, thoroughly wash the affected skin area with soap and water, then gently pat it dry with a clean towel.
  2. Apply the Ointment: Apply a small amount of the ointment—enough to create a thin, even layer—to the injured skin. Avoid touching the tube's tip to your skin or any other surface to prevent contamination.
  3. Frequency: The medication is typically applied to the affected area one to three times a day, or as otherwise directed by a physician.
  4. Covering: The treated area may be covered with a sterile bandage or gauze if desired.
  5. Hand Washing: Always wash your hands well with soap and water before and after application.

Important Considerations

  • Duration of Use: Do not use this topical antibiotic for more than seven days unless specifically advised by a healthcare provider. Prolonged use may lead to the overgrowth of non-susceptible organisms.
  • Avoid Contact: Do not allow the ointment to get into your eyes, nose, or mouth. If accidental contact occurs, rinse the area thoroughly with water.
  • Severe Injuries: This medication is not intended for the treatment of severe injuries, such as deep cuts, puncture wounds, animal bites, or serious burns. Seek immediate medical attention for these types of wounds, as they may require different treatment.
  • Allergic Reactions: Stop using the product and contact your doctor immediately if you experience signs of an allergic reaction, such as a rash, itching, or worsening of the treated condition.

Frequently Asked Questions (FAQ)

Common questions about Nebactrina (Bacitracin, Neomycin) (FAQ)

Q: Why does Nebactrina contain two different antibiotics (Bacitracin and Neomycin)?

Nebactrina is described as a combination antibiotic because it strategically incorporates two distinct active ingredients. The goal of this combination is to address bacteria through different pathways, which is defined in official documents as a comprehensive strategy against bacterial growth. This allows the product to broaden its antimicrobial action against susceptible microbes.

Q: What is the described risk of an allergic reaction to the neomycin component of Nebactrina?

Official information documents allergic sensitization, which can manifest as rash and irritation, as the most frequently reported reaction associated with this product. Regulatory labels indicate that the topical Neomycin component may cause cutaneous sensitization (a skin allergy). Patients who are sensitive to neomycin may also experience cross-allergy to other medications in the aminoglycoside class.

Q: Can the ingredients in Nebactrina be absorbed through the skin into the body?

The product is generally not appreciably absorbed when applied to intact skin. However, official documents describe the potential for significant systemic absorption of the Neomycin component when the product is applied to large surface areas. The risk is also documented when the medicine is used on injured areas where the skin barrier is compromised, such as wounds or burns.

Q: Are systemic side effects a possibility with Nebactrina, and what are the signs?

Serious systemic effects are documented as rare possibilities associated with significant absorption into the bloodstream. These include ototoxicity, which is the potential for hearing damage, and nephrotoxicity, which is the potential for kidney damage. These risks are described when systemic exposure to the Neomycin component occurs.

Q: What types of systemic medications are described in official documents as potentially interacting with Nebactrina components?

Official documents restrict co-administration with other systemic medications that are potentially neurotoxic or nephrotoxic, such as other systemic aminoglycosides. Caution is also advised regarding the co-administration with neuromuscular blocking agents, which may amplify certain effects. Additionally, potent diuretics are cited as potentially enhancing Neomycin toxicity.

Q: Is there specific guidance regarding the use of Nebactrina with other antibiotics taken orally?

Official documents restrict co-administration with other systemic aminoglycosides due to the risk of additive toxicity if systemic absorption of Nebactrina occurs. Guidance on interaction with oral antibiotics from other classes is not explicitly detailed in the regulatory profile.

Q: What is the guidance for using Nebactrina in young children or infants?

Regulatory information often states that the safety and effectiveness of this product are often stated as not established in pediatric patients. For children under the age of two, regulatory labels typically advise that consultation with a healthcare provider before use is appropriate.

Q: Are older adults or geriatric patients described as needing different considerations for Nebactrina use?

Regulatory labels contain notes that the risk of systemic interaction is documented as increased for patients of advanced age. This is linked to the risk of Neomycin absorption and its potential effects. This information suggests that careful consideration of use in geriatric patients is necessary.

Q: Is Nebactrina suitable for treating wounds that appear to be deep or infected?

The product is explicitly not intended for severe injuries such as deep cuts, puncture wounds, or serious burns. If the treated condition worsens or involves signs like purulent discharge or severe irritation, regulatory labeling advises discontinuing use. Regulatory labeling notes that consulting a physician is appropriate when the condition worsens or involves discharge.

Q: Does Nebactrina work against infections caused by viruses or fungi?

Nebactrina is an antibiotic and is intended to stop the growth of bacteria. Regulatory contraindications for the product include use on viral lesions of the skin, such as Herpes, or fungal lesions. Therefore, it is not described as a treatment for non-bacterial pathogens.

Q: What is the difference between Nebactrina and single-antibiotic ointments?

Nebactrina is identified as a combination antibiotic because it incorporates two different active ingredients: Bacitracin and Neomycin. This composition contrasts with single-antibiotic ointments that contain only one active agent. The two-ingredient formula is noted for its ability to address bacteria through distinct pathways.

Q: What are the general signs that Nebactrina may be causing a local reaction rather than helping the wound?

Regulatory labels advise stopping use of the product if the condition persists or gets worse after a standard period of use. Additionally, users are advised to consult a physician if symptoms of a rash, spreading irritation, or other allergic reaction develop. Worsening symptoms are noted in documentation as circumstances under which consultation is advised.

Q: Does the application of Nebactrina create an environment that helps reduce scarring?

Regulatory documents and research summaries do not make direct claims or address scarring outcomes related to the use of Nebactrina. Applying an ointment can help maintain a moist healing environment, but no promissory claims about reducing scar formation are made in official sources.

Q: What are the key safety considerations for using Nebactrina on large areas of skin?

The use of the product on large areas of the body is restricted because it increases the risk of systemic absorption of the neomycin component. This systemic absorption is documented as carrying a risk of ototoxicity (hearing damage) and nephrotoxicity (kidney damage). Use is also restricted on skin areas where the barrier is compromised.

Q: Is there any information available on using Nebactrina during pregnancy?

Regulatory bodies advise caution or state that the medicine should be used only if clearly needed during pregnancy. This advisory is based on the theoretical risk of systemic absorption of neomycin, which could lead to potential fetal toxicity. The decision for use is a matter for consultation with a healthcare provider.

Q: What are the general considerations for using Nebactrina while breastfeeding?

Caution is advised when administering the product to a nursing woman because it is not known if the drug is excreted in human milk. The caution is due to the theoretical risk of Neomycin being systemically absorbed and potentially passing into breast milk. Official documentation notes that consultation with a healthcare provider regarding this use is appropriate.

Q: What is the guidance on using Nebactrina on blistered or raw skin areas?

Regulatory labeling indicates that use is restricted on denuded skin (which includes raw or blistered areas). This restriction is mandatory because the compromised skin barrier increases the risk of the neomycin systemic absorption and its associated toxicities, such as kidney or hearing damage.

Q: What is meant by a 'superficial' skin infection in the context of Nebactrina's use?

The product is intended for localized anti-infective protection in minor, uncomplicated injuries, such as simple cuts, scrapes, and minor burns. Official documentation explicitly states it is not intended for deep cuts, puncture wounds, or severe injuries, which helps define the boundaries of superficial use.

Q: Is there any known risk associated with accidental ingestion of a small amount of Nebactrina ointment?

Regulatory labels advise that if the product is accidentally swallowed, contacting a Poison Control Center or seeking medical help immediately is appropriate. The product's safety information notes that it may be harmful if swallowed and may cause irritation. The product is strictly for topical use on the skin.

How should Nebactrina be stored and disposed of?

How to Store and Dispose of Bacitracin and Neomycin Topical Ointment

The storage and disposal of Bacitracin and Neomycin combination ointment must adhere strictly to regulatory labeling to maintain product quality and ensure safety.

Storage Requirements

The medication must be stored at controlled room temperature, typically 15 C to 30 C (59 F to 86 F). It is mandatory to protect the product from freezing and keep it away from excess heat and moisture; therefore, storage in the bathroom is prohibited. The ointment must remain in its original container and be kept tightly closed.

Child-Safety and Disposal

The product must be stored out of the sight and reach of children, and safety caps must always be locked. For disposal, the preferred method is a medicine take-back program. The medication must not be flushed down the toilet or poured down any drain. If a take-back program is unavailable, the unneeded medicine should be mixed with an undesirable substance, placed in a sealed bag, and discarded with the household trash.
